		<description>We have car conversations on the way to school in the morning.  My kindergartener and I talk about how he won't forget to put his name on his paper (and I have him "air write" his name, we say things that are positive statements, "I'm going to have fun with my friend ______", we talk about the best part of yesterday was (the story on the rug).  And finally, he decides if mommy should be sitting on the benches or standing at the fence when he comes walking out at the end of the day. Then my second grader gets his turn to tell me what's on his mind. By the way, the first kid in the car with his seatbelt fastened gets to go FIRST!</description>
